SSAB, Fortum explore hydrogen-reduced sponge iron

SSAB and Fortum say they will launch a front-end engineering design (FEED) study to explore the possibilities of making hydrogen-reduced sponge iron at the Raahe mill in Finland, Kallanish learns. FEED studies are designed to control project expenses and thoroughly plan a project before a fixed bid quote is submitted.
